Kashmir Earthquake Forms New Lakes
2000 x 2000 3 MB - JPEG
Published December 20, 2005
Two months after a magnitude 7.6 earthquake shook Kashmir, water continued to build behind a natural dam. The dam was created when a landslide covered two rivers, which are now pooling into lakes in the valleys beyond the slide.
